Hi Everyone, I am new to this site.

I am from Bronkhorstspruit, South Africa (Yes; it is on Google maps!)

I have my CNC machine since 2008 but now I have a strange phenomenon.

I have an E-Z router running Mach 3 and this is my problem of late. During the cut the Y-axis will all of a sudden go for a “Walk-about” in its own direction.

When I stop the machine and Reference All Home, the Z and X axis reference fine BUT the Y axis move away from the home position. Instead of coming back to the left rear position it is simply moving away down the Y axis.

I replaced the 25-pin parallel cable, replaced the Y axis limit switch, replaced the connector blocks on both the Y axis stepper motors, to no avail. I contacted E Z Router in Texas but they do not seem to have an answer for me.

Anyone have a suggestion of what may be the problem.

Thanks in advance.

Newbie still on the fence for uccnc vs mach3

$
0
0
Building my own small cnc (about 650mm X 450mm) and trying to decide between the 2. So far the general consensus is that guys prefer uccnc and think it's easier to use for a beginner. I'm 99% sure I want to go uccnc, but there's one hang up I have. When searching for tutorial videos, they are endless for mach3 and not common at all for uccnc. For example if I want to search for something specific like how to setup dual screw/ dual stepper for X using a slave on uccnc, I can't really find specifics like how to set it up to calibrate squareness with 2 home switches. Much more info available for mach3. Should I be worried about this? Or should I just trust that I can rely on you guys to help me out with uccnc when needed? So far my experience on this forum has been great. Plenty of experienced guys willing to help. I think I would be OK even with the lack of tutorials for uccnc, but I'm still open to suggestions and opinions on one vs the other. If it makes much difference, I'll be running a g540 and most likely a uc100. Possibly skip the uc100 if I go mach3 to keep price down.

Any advice is appreciated!

Problem No Post Processor for THC301?

$
0
0
I run SheetCam with Mach3 and a THC301 made by Texas MicroCircuits. Use a machine torch with a scriber plate marker. Thermal Dynamics A60.

Attached is a text file of the Post Processor file I am using.

This Post Processor is "Designed for use with Mach3 and CandCNC MP1000-THC and Floating head Touch-n-Go\n"

Has anyone made a Post Processor file specifically for the THC301?

The reason I want to know is that after a lot of troubleshooting with "Arc OK" issues, I'm hoping find an optimum configuration for my machine. I can cut a part or two without much trouble. But when I have a nest of parts or a part with multiple pierces, my machine will stop upon making a new pierce. The torch remains on but the machine won't advance, no "Arc OK" signal.

Running SheetCam V 4.0.10 on my machine. (I've looked at version 6.0.23 and it still did not have a PP for THC301)

Should I continue down this path, or is the Post Processor file a non-issue for my "Arc OK" issues?

Thanks for reading,

NEW DIY CNC WOOD ROUTER SPINDLE HOOKUP

$
0
0
Hello Everyone,
First time here. I have been building a new CNC wood router for my home shop. It is approx. 5' by 8.5' I have used rack and pinion on X and Y axis's and a ballscrew on the Z axis. All axis's are moved by Teknic Clearpath SD motors. The spindle is a UGRA air cooled spindle motor with a DELTA M vfd. I am using Windows 7 PRO, MACH 3 and a C23 board with smoothstepper with Ethernet connection.
Now for my trouble....I cannot figure out the hookup for the VFD to run the spindle. All parameters at set in the VFD for using 0-10 volt AVI and GRD. The NO relay for MO and GRD, However I never get the 0-10 volt out of the board to command the VFD. I have Configured the Mach 3 Ports and Pins / Sindle setup to Output #1 for both M3 and M4. Also have turned on the outputs for port 1 and pins 14 (0-10 volt output pin) and 16 (NO relay) but no output out of the board to run the VFD. I have tried everything. I really need some help here. Thank You very much in advance.
